ClassIsland
2025年5月4日大约 5 分钟
一款适用于班级一体机的课程信息显示软件,支持显示当日课表、课程信息与各 组件
信息,具有丰富的 插件系统
,支持各种精细化设置。
本项目名称的灵感源于 iOS 灵动岛(Dynamic Island)
,受到 DuguSand/class_form
的启发而开发。
主界面

- 支持通过自定义
隐藏规则集
在特定情况下自动隐藏,灵活应对各种情景
组件配置
自定义主界面显示内容,如日期、时间、课程表、天气简报、倒数日、自定义文本、轮播组件、分组组件
- 支持自定义相对行号、隐藏规则集与更多高级设置
- 课程表组件
- 轮播组件、分组组件满足更多需求
- 天气简报组件支持显示降雨剩余时间
- 高级设置
- 课程表组件
主题设置

通过主题设置高度定制应用主界面外观(主题下载)
注
需要保证应用版本为 1.5.3.1 及以上,且安装 ClassIsland 主题加载器
插件





档案编辑
提示
应在编辑好科目
与时间表
之后编辑课表
换课
- 支持当日和跨日换课
调休
- 支持提前预定要启用的课表、安排调休课表
附加设置
提醒
- 支持
上下课提醒
、放学提醒
、天气/预警提醒
、行动提醒
,可设置提醒优先级,提醒横幅可自选搭配提醒音效
、强调特效
和提醒语音
自动化
- 支持在特定时间节点或情况下执行特定操作,如切换组件配置、运行程序、显示提醒等
- 支持多个不同配置方案,可通过拖动进行排序
插件
- 支持通过安装插件的方式扩展应用功能,如添加更多新组件、自动化行动、规则集规则、提醒提供方、认证提供方等
- 可在应用内的插件市场中安装插件或从本地安装

ExtraIsland
为 ClassIsland 提供多种扩展功能!

ClassIsland 主题加载器
为 ClassIsland 加载自定义主题,个性化您的界面。

地震预警
防范于未然,为您争取宝贵避险时间。
UIAccess 提权
为 ClassIsland 提升 UIAccess 令牌,使 ClassIsland 可以置顶到全屏 UWP 应用和系统界面上。
更多功能
- 回声洞、调试菜单
- 从壁纸提取主题色
- 运行保障
- 支持在发生崩溃时自动退出,不影响教学任务
- 应用数据备份
- 自动时间同步
- 支持自动从公开的 NTP 服务器或学校广播服务器的 NTP 服务同步时间,提高提醒等功能与学校铃声的同步性
- 支持自定义时间偏移和自动调整时间偏移
- 密码保护
- 支持为部分功能设置密码,如编辑应用设置、档案等,减小应用配置被篡改的可能性
- 应用内自动更新
- 获取调试信息
集控管理
支持通过静态配置文件或集控服务器部署,统一管理档案配置、应用策略等,提高管理多个实例的便利性
- 官方集控服务器(🚧开发中,即将发布)
- 基于 Python 的第三方集控服务器
- 开始使用